Understanding the German Drogerie
To genuinely appreciate the German drugstore, one need to first understand the difference in between a Drogerie and an Apotheke (pharmacy).
- The Apotheke (Pharmacy): This is where prescription medications, strong over-the-counter drugs, and specialized medical advice are dispensed. They are strictly controlled and traditionally staffed by pharmacists in white coats.
- The Drogerie (Drugstore): This is where one opts for health, appeal, UnterstüTzung Beim Abnehmen Deutschland personal care, child products, cleaning up products, and healthy foods. Prescription drugs are not offered here.
The modern German drugstore market is controlled by a couple of significant chains, creating a duopoly that forms the shopping habits of countless residents each and every single day.

Founded in 1973, dm is a cultural example in Germany. Germans consistently vote dm as their preferred merchant. The stores are thoroughly organized, wheelchair- and stroller-friendly, and lit with warm, Top-Bewertete NahrungsergäNzungsmittel Deutschland (Xerciseup.Com) inviting lighting. dm is especially famous for pioneering the "private label" transformation in Germany, providing premium-quality cosmetics and skin care at a fraction of the cost of name brands.
2. Dirk Rossmann GmbH (Rossmann)
As the second-largest chain, Rossmann is common throughout German towns and cities. Rossmann is understood for aggressive discounting, weekly discount coupon books, and a great digital app. While its store design can often feel slightly more practical than dm, its item range is similarly excellent.
3. Müller
Müller differ due to the fact that it works practically like a mini-department store. While it has the very same extensive pharmacy and natural food sections as dm and Rossmann, a common Müller will likewise include a huge toy department, a stationery and book area, and a high-end luxury fragrance counter.
What Can You Actually Buy?
A common mistake beginners make is presuming they require to visit numerous boutique for their family needs. In reality, a German pharmacy covers almost all non-grocery, non-pharmaceutical daily needs.
Here is a breakdown of what buyers will discover inside:
- Cosmetics and Makeup: From affordable brands like Essence and Catrice to mid-tier favorites like Maybelline and L'Oréal, plus a booming market of tidy beauty brands.
- Skincare and Body Care: An enormous wall committed to lotions, shower gels, and body oils. Brand names like Nivea, Eucerin, Medikamente Kaufen Deutschland and La Roche-Posay are staples.
- Haircare: Everything from professional hair salon brand names to natural, silicone-free shampoos (like Alverde or Weleda).
- Baby & & Toddler Section: A paradise for moms and dads. This includes diapers (typically private label, highly ranked), formula, baby food containers, and natural child clothing.
- Bio/ Organic Foods (Reformhaus products): Over the last decade, German drugstores have actually evolved into health-food stores. Buyers can find organic oats, vegan snacks, superfood powders, plant-based milks, and natural teas.
- Family Cleaning Supplies: Eco-friendly cleaning agents, dishwashing liquids, sponges, and surface area cleaners. Germany takes sustainability seriously, and environmentally friendly cleansing lines are heavily featured.
The Magic of German Drugstore House Brands (Eigenmarken)
One of the biggest secrets of the German drugstore is the quality of its private-label brands. In numerous countries, store-brand products are seen as cheap, inferior alternatives to call brand names. In Germany, the reverse is often real.
German customer magazines (like Stiftung Warentest) frequently test pharmacy house brand names against luxury brands, and Eigenmarken often win leading honors for quality, active ingredient safety, and value.
Popular House Brands to Look For:
- Balea (dm): The undisputed king of spending plan body care. From shower gels that alter scents seasonally to abundant body milks and facial serums, Balea is a cult favorite.
- Alverde (dm): A qualified natural cosmetics (Naturkosmetik) brand name that is exceptionally affordable.
- Isana (Rossmann): Similar to Balea, providing a huge variety of hair, skin, and bath items with excellent performance evaluations.
- Babylove (dm) & & Babydream (Rossmann): Lifesavers for parents, providing high-performing diapers and infant care items without the premium price.
Tips for Shopping Like a Local
If you want to blend in flawlessly throughout your next trip down the drugstore aisles in Germany, keep these useful tips in mind:
- Bring Your Own Bags: Like most German merchants, drugstores do not give out complimentary plastic bags. Constantly carry a recyclable tote bag (Jutebeutel).
- Download the Apps: If you live in Germany or visit regularly, download the dm or Rossmann apps. They use digital discount coupons, commitment points, and scratch-and-win discounts that can save you a significant amount of money.
- Shop the Sale Bins: Near the front or center of the shops, you will frequently discover clearance bins including seasonal items, ceased scents, or overstocked items greatly marked down.
- Examine the Certifications: German consumers care deeply about sustainability. Look for relied on German seals on items, such as:
- Natrue: Certified natural cosmetics.
- Vegan Flower: Certified 100% vegan products.
- Blauer Engel: Germany's main eco-label for ecologically friendly products.
- Coin for the Shopping Cart: If you need a shopping cart, you will need a 1-euro or 50-cent coin to unlock it (which you return when you return it).
